Job Description:
Business Overview
AI & Data Division:
An organization that develops and operates the AI and data infrastructure of the Rakuten Group.
Department Overview
Search Department:
An organization that develops and operates the common search engine platform (GSP) of Rakuten Group.
Search Engineering Section:
An organization of engineering within the Search Department responsible for design, development, and operation.
Search Service Engineering Group:
An organization that adapts service systems to GSP when each service development team develops a system.
Position:
Why We Hire
We are recruiting members to meet needs such as expanding the search platform’s capabilities and scope of use, and optimizing costs.
Position Details
We are seeking a mid to senior level engineer capable of independently leading the following:
- Eliciting requirements from internal tech clients and translating them into feasible designs using GSP Schema, Query, and Processing Logic
- Reviewing and consulting on schema and query design, and implementing changes as required
- Designing, developing, and operating web applications and data synchronizer batches that support GSP
- Responding to incidents and inquiries and implementing preventive improvements
Work Environment
The team is about 10 members, mainly engineers, with ages ranging from the 20s to the 50s. The gender ratio is roughly even, and the team currently consists mostly of Japanese members. New graduates and mid-career hires, as well as full-time and contract staff, work together on the team.
Tech Stack: RockyLinux/Solr/OpenSearch/Cassandra/MySQL/MariaDB/Python/TypeScript/JavaScript/Next.js/Java
Mandatory Qualifications:
- Ability to independently drive schema and query design and requirements alignment with internal clients
- 5+ years of experience in system development and operations
- Development experience with RDBMS/NoSQL
Desired Qualifications:
- Web application development experience
- Development experience in Python, JavaScript, or TypeScript
- Search engine experience (Solr, Elasticsearch, or OpenSearch)
- RDBMS/NoSQL operation experience
- Native Level Japanese or JLPT N1
#engineer #applicationsengineer #DataEngineer #aianddatadiv #Python